What will I learn?

Open up a world of employment options. With Massey’s Master of Arts (Economics) you’ll build on your undergraduate interests and develop your analysis and research skills. With a Master of Arts (Economics) at Massey, you’ll investigate how businesses decide what to produce and how many people to employ, explore how people decide what to consume, and learn about big-picture world economics. This qualification will help you in your own decision-making, and in better understanding developments in the economy and society in general. It offers ways of thinking about the world that let you make the best of what you have, and improve on it. Massey’s MA (Economics) gives you flexibility in the subjects you study. You could explore topics such as international trade in agri-food products, or natural resource and environmental economics. You’ll build on your undergraduate degree and further investigate topics in economics that have taken your interest.

Entry requirements

For international students

All students must meet university entrance requirements to be admitted to the University.Specific requirementsTo enter the Master of Arts Economics you will have been awarded or qualified fora Bachelor of Arts degree or equivalent with a major in the intended postgraduate subject with at least a B grade average across the 200300 level major coursesa Bachelor of Arts Honours with a subject in the intended postgraduate subject or a Postgraduate Diploma in Arts with an endorsement in the intended postgraduate subject or an equivalent qualification with at least a B grade average across the 700 level courses for entry to the Research Pathway or a B grade average across the 700 level courses for entry to the Coursework Pathway.If you have a BA Hons or PGDipArts in the intended Master of Arts subject as outlined above you may apply for credit towards Part One of the qualification in accordance with the limits specified in the Recognition of Prior Learning regulations.You will need to provide verified copies of all academic transcripts for studies taken at all universities other than Massey University.
